She had to admit, she was glad that she had not been scolded for her mention of Tobias with such an obvious distate. Perhaps she shouldn't have expected it. After all, she had a difficult time imagining any wolf who might take pity upon him; he had become a slave to his instincts first and now, he seemed to be a slave to some other thing. He had never been the one to seek dominance through a pack, after all. She had grown up alongside he and his stories and though he dominated any wolf he came across, he had never once sought to take part in pack affairs. So, what had made Asteraia different? Even if he had changed, even the slightest, she had no doubts that he'd still present as a risk. She'd always despise him. Even when he died, she had no doubt she'd still utter his name with venom.

Thankfully, she had been entirely distracted by the arrival of Tithe. She issued him a stout, brief bow of her head in greeting, an ear flicked towards him as he assumed their purpose. She liked him, to be truthful, but she had never been too good at showing that. To anybody, in fact. Even now, she had her suspicions that Sleekwing did not know that she actually liked him. There was more to it than a mere sense of obligation. The same could have been said of Tithe; she liked him, but she had no idea how to show it, particularly when they had come together again to discuss something that tasted like sand in her mouth.

Daenerys took the lead swiftly and so, Malina had fallen back into a more comfortable position as she briefly assessed her observations and how to articulate them. She'd have no issue letting Tithe speak first, and she'd wait patiently if he had the initiative to do so.

"Well," she had finally begun, rocking forth and stepping slightly so as to bring the attention to her as she moved to speak, "I had an opportunity to meet with one of their young. To be precise, she was their Princess. Nevermore, I believe it was." She had been strange, sure, but she had been friendly enough. Galileo had been right to be suspect and she wondered, briefly with a sheepish grin to herself, if her indiscretion there would be revealed now that he had returned to Spirane with the offer. "She seemed interested in meeting other children, and I have a feeling she has not met many others before. However, that was not the... concerning part of our meeting."

She paused, allowing both of her company to process the information before she continued, her brows now furrowed. "She was adamant that she could not leave the territory in fear that others would kill her," she stated simply, her eyes darting between Tithe and Daenerys's, "it seems there is a paranoia in the pack. I cannot say if it originates from their leaders though I suspect it. It may create tension in the future. One mistake, or misunderstanding, may incite something to... flare up, I suppose. Paranoia is a...volatile thing, after all."

She was curious to see how they would take that, for it had certainly been something of interest to her. Sure, a treaty might save them the pain of Tobias lurking about but what else could it potentially let in? Malina had some ideas, though she ought to not speak them too publicly she thought. See, what if Daenerys lost credibility... in a sense? Or power, however one might see it. If she had to watch her every step, and the every step of her pack, in fear of inciting some fear of Asteraia's queen... would it be worth the assumed safety? Nonetheless, she proceeded with what she saw as a potential manipulation of that.

"We could use that, of course," she stated after several moments of quiet, her lip twitching back in a brief grin that she had quickly wiped away, "See, we could show Asteraia that we, and by extension Spirane's children, are not the one's who seek to cause harm. It may be beneficial, in a sense, to gain the affections or favor of their daughter, who I assume might be their heir. Long term insurance, one might call it."

**Any position may be challenged for at any time. Please privately contact Nymeria and she will decide the type and style of challenge appropriate to the rank.

Abhorsen - The Wielder: Alpha female and Queen of Spirane. Her word is final in all matters. Vows to protect and lead those who call the mountain home.

Her Council
Belgaer - The Thinker: Second in Command, this wolf is the Abhorsen's most trusted compatriot and confidant. In the Abhorsen's absence, they are able to speak with her authority.
Saraneth - The Binder: Chosen mate of the Abhorsen. They can settle pack disputes, accept members, assign tasks, and leads the pack during hunts, in times of war, or in cases where the Abhorsen is not present.
Scion - The Successor: The Abhorsen's heir, training to one day fill her paw prints. This wolf must become adept in multiple trades. This wolf is expected to become proficient in healing, fighting, hunting, diplomacy, and thievery. They are expected to lend assistance to any of the other ranks if ever needed.

The Bells
Dyrim - The Speaker: Lead diplomat and is often times sent out to maintain good relations with allied packs. Charged with educating the Ambassadors in diplomatic ways.
Astarael - The Weeper: The commander and lead warrior of the pack. Charged with teaching the Berserkers the art of battle.
Clayr - The Seer: Charged with the pack's health, and in teaching the Shiners and those who wish to pursue the art of healing.
Kibeth - The Walker: The leader of the Guard. They are the foremost line of defense, charged with securing the borders and bringing pertinent information from within and without the pack to the appropriate wolf. They also lead the Outriders.
Ranna - The Sleeper: Assists the queen in guarding from theft as well as advising her of news and gossip from the whole of Moladion. Charged with teaching the Mages about theft, secret keeping, and overall sneakiness. Allowed to make and block steals.
Mosrael - The Waker: Caretaker and storyteller of the pack, also the head pupsitter. Often times this wolf will look after the pack's youth and educate them of Spirane and Moladion's history. Leads the Remembrancers in pup watching.
Charter - The Power: The master hunter of the pack. Leads and organizes all hunts and teaches the Falconers the art of the hunt.

The Classes
Berserkers: Warriors and hunters of the pack.
Falconers: The pack hunters
Mages: Thieves and secret keepers of the pack. Allowed to make and block steals.
Ambassadors: Diplomats of the pack.
Shiners: Healers of the pack.
Outriders: The pack scouts who bring all news of happenings across Moladion back.
Remembrancers: Wolves of a kind nature who look after the younger wolves of the pack. These wolves may wish to learn more about healing, but this is not a requirement.
Bairns: The young pups of the pack
Amateurs: Youth of the pack still finding their place

Kinfolk: The general populance of the pack
Elders: Respected retirees who still offer wisdom and insight
